Chaparral High School vs Summit View Elementary School
PARKER, CO 路 School Comparison
2022 Data 路 NCES CCD| Metric | Chaparral High School | Summit View Elementary School |
|---|---|---|
| Enrollment | 2,009 | 430 |
| Student-Teacher Ratio | 19.4:1 | 17.1:1 |
| Free/Reduced Lunch | N/A | 2.1% |
| Diversity | Moderate | Moderate |
| School Type | Regular High School | Regular Combined School |
| Locale | Unknown | Unknown |

Student Demographics
| Race/Ethnicity | Chaparral High School | Summit View Elementary School |
|---|---|---|
| White | 68.0% | 78.8% |
| Hispanic | 18.3% | 9.1% |
| Black | 2.7% | 0.5% |
| Asian | 5.2% | 5.6% |
